The Forbes Netball Association will be represented by two teams this coming weekend, when they compete in the 50th year of the Netball NSW State Age Championships.

The Championship is one of the largest female sporting events in the Southern Hemisphere, where over 3000 players in over 300 teams will compete over three days of competition.
Four age groups will be contested, from 12 years to 15 years, with Forbes NA represented in 12 years and 14 years in Division 3, playing Saturday, Sunday and Monday at the Eastwood Ryde netball courts.
The Forbes group will have many parents to support the two teams, when every team must have a coach, manager, primary carer and scorer for their bench for every game, plus lots of cheerers.
The Forbes Netball Association must also supply an umpire per team, plus one and will be represented by Aurella White, Hannah Staines and Karen Hargraves.
The FNA Committee and members wish all the players and umpires good luck, and play and umpire to the best of your ability and with outstanding sportsmanship, as all Forbes players have displayed over many years.

14 years
By coach Robyn Kenny
The 14 years team is made up of, Georgina Stitt (captain), Lauren Bate (vice-captain), Elsa Cusack, Gabby White, Ellie Flick, Ella Higgins, Amy Cusack, Tilly Aveyard. Coach Robyn Kenny, Manager Deb Bate, Primary Carer Kristy Butler.
The team has been training twice a week since early March, and attended regional training carnivals, where they have tasted success in their own age group.
The team played up an age group at many of the carnivals, to give them the extra match practice needed to compete successfully this weekend, in the higher division of division 3.
The team of Georgina Stitt, Lauren Bate, Ellie Flick and Ella Higgins have all successfully tasted the demanding competition of State Age Championships in their own age group of 13 and 12 years, over the past two years, with Gabby White playing in the 12 years age group in 2017, and Elsa Cusack, Amy Cusask and Tilly Aveyard all competing for the first time at State Age Championships.
The team has trained with determination and has improved dramatically during the training season.
Regional training carnivals for match practice have been few and far between over the last period, but all the girls have tried their hardest to improve and have bonded extremely well, to form a very competitive team.
There will be a parade of banners to open the championships at 8am on Saturday, with games starting at 9-30 am, where the Forbes 14s will play Casino, Great Lakes, Barellan, Ballina and Wollondilly, with Nelson Bay, Muswellbrook, Southern Highlands, Tamworth and Singleton all in the running for top honours with Forbes, over the three days.
The 14s will play 6 games on Saturday, 7 games on a huge day on Sunday, and 5 games and a bye on Monday.
Under 12s
By coach Lyn Ford
The 2018 Forbes 12s rep team have had a busy lead up to State Age Championships. The girls have been attending two training sessions each week for the last 3 months, as well as attending 6 training carnivals, and keeping up with other sporting, school and personal commitments.
There have been a few problems with illness and injury, but these girls continue to “soldier on”. The girls have all shown personal improvement, and although I feel we are lacking in match fitness, I am sure they will perform well at State Age.
I am enjoying this time coaching this group of young ladies, who are not only enthusiastic and positive girls, but who all share a great sense of humour and a great team spirit.
The team consists of Isla Worland, Tanesha Riddle, Andie Hodder, Katie Crouch, Ella White, Ebonnie Hopley, Ava Hui, Kate Stephenson, Bella Walker and Coco Gracie, along with Manager Felicity Worland, Primary Carer Juliet Hodder and great supportive parents. I look forward to reporting on some positive results on our return.
